Saltillo, Texas
Template:Short description Template:Use mdy dates Saltillo is an unincorporated community in Hopkins County, Texas, United States.[1] It is located sixteen miles east of Sulphur Springs at the intersection of US 67 and FM 900. Saltillo has a population of approximately 300. Despite being unincorporated, Saltillo has its own post office, assigned the ZIP Code 75457. The Saltillo Independent School District serves area students.
